| Title | Acmailer - Improper Access Control to OS Command Injection |
|---|---|
| Author | daffainfo |
| Severity | Critical |
| Impact | Attackers can execute arbitrary OS commands or escalate privileges, potentially leading to full system compromise and sensitive data exposure. |
| Remediation | Update to the latest version of acmailer and acmailer DB to address the issue. |
| CVSS Score | 9.8 |
| EPSS Score | 0.40785 |
| CVE ID | CVE-2021-20617 |
| CWE ID | NVD-CWE-Other |
| Shodan Query | title="ACMAILER4.0" |
| Fofa Query | title="ACMAILER4.0" |
| Tags | cve cve2021 acmailer rce vkev oast oob |
Improper access control vulnerability in acmailer ver. 4.0.1 and earlier, and acmailer DB ver. 1.1.3 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ute an arbitrary OS command, or gain an administrative privilege which may result in obtaining the sensitive information on the server via unspecified vectors.
